## 2.8.1 — Key rotation

Heads up, on-call: we rotated the signing key for Inkmill, our markdown rendering pipeline, after the old one aged out of policy. Rendered-bundle verification will fail on anything cached before today — just purge and re-render, don't panic. The worker fleet picked up the new key automatically. For manual verification, the active key is below.

release key, hadug-kawef: bky13_mPGeFZeR1GZ1G

## Local setup

Clone the Skardell autoscaler repo, install deps with `make bootstrap`, then run `make dev`. The scaler polls queue depth from Brimqueue every five seconds; tune the interval in scaler.toml if your laptop lags. Metrics need the local stats database running. Export your environment, then set the metrics store to the connection string below.

primary connection of tajeg-tajop = postgresql://julax_svc:DI@db-e7f3.kelvidyn.corp:5432/rusdor

## Enable hot-reloading of service configuration

This PR lets the Corvasse gateway pick up config changes without a restart. A watcher polls the config store, validates the new snapshot, and swaps it atomically; invalid snapshots are rejected and the previous config stays live. Handlers read config through a versioned accessor, so in-flight requests are unaffected. New folks: see `config/reload.md` for the flow. Polling and validation behavior is governed by the constants below.

tuning constants:
QUOTAS = {
    "druwyn": 5,
    "holix": 5,
    "zorath": 5,
    "holwyn": 10,
}

Subject: Handover — Quillgate websocket reconnect bug

Hi Varen,

Taking over release duty from me this week. The open issue is the Quillgate client dropping websocket connections after idle timeout and failing to reconnect without a full page reload. Fix is staged on release/2.14.3; QA signed off this morning. You'll need to push the hotfix bundle yourself. The deploy key for the staging signer is below.

rollout seal: bky9_PeXH1fTLY